We introduce MVImgnet, a large-scale dataset of multi-view images, which is efficiently collected by shooting videos of real-world objects. It enjoys 3D-aware signals from multi-view consistency, being a soft bridge between 2D and 3D vision. Through dense reconstruction on MVImgNet, we also present a large-scale real-world 3D object point cloud dataset -MVPNet.
